The original finding aid described this as:

Description: Blurred view of the moon through an aurora, as observed from the Space Shuttle Endeavour during STS-68.

Subject Terms: STS-68, ENDEAVOUR (ORBITER), CELESTIAL BODIES, MOON, LIGHT (VISIBLE RADIATION), LUMINESCENCE, AURORAS

Date Taken: 1/7/1998

Categories: Earth Observations

Interior_Exterior: Exterior

Ground_Orbit: On-orbit

Original: Film - 35MM CN

Preservation File Format: TIFF
